Key Questions
Can these landscape tricks be used in any climate?
Most of these techniques are adaptable to various climates, especially when selecting native and drought-resistant plants suited to local conditions. However, effectiveness may vary depending on regional soil and weather patterns.
Are these tricks expensive to implement?
Initial costs can vary. Some strategies, like planting native species and installing smart irrigation, may require upfront investment but typically result in long-term water savings and reduced maintenance costs.
Do these techniques require special maintenance?
Many of these tricks reduce ongoing maintenance. For example, native plants generally need less watering and fertilizing. Smart irrigation systems may require setup and occasional adjustments.
